Output 18da33420f10d673ea12309f39681bfb89685f7923dfd7457871cb2085674e22:2

value
29964700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a341494fb7db2a9387dda7af1aef89a15ad82baa OP_EQUAL
address
3GaEGzJc6MFXghoJxHrs3dMYeLrxz5fLHM
transaction
18da33420f10d673ea12309f39681bfb89685f7923dfd7457871cb2085674e22
spent
true